Baseball Opens Conference Play Versus Eckerd

Bucs start SSC slate this weekend

MIAMI SHORES, Fla. -- The 2016 season has started strong for Barry baseball with highlight wins over nationally-ranked Catawba and a series win over Wisconsin-Parkside, but now the real challenge begins. The Buccaneers will open Sunshine State Conference play this weekend as they take on the Tritons of Eckerd.

In 2015, the Bucs finished 7th in the conference and will be aiming to raise their position to one of the best in the league.

The effort to regain that stature begins this weekend as Barry takes on a Tritons team that comes in from a 6-3 loss to Ave Maria on Wednesday night.

Threats on the Tritons roster include RHP Nick Hill, a pitcher with a rare acumen at the plate. The senior leads the team with seven RBI, 10 total bases and is tied for first with one homerun.

Junior infielder Lucas Luopa leads the Tritons in hits with eight and 15 at-bats.

On the mound, Eckerd will rely on arms like those of senior LHP Kevin Plant, who leads the team with six strikeouts and sophomore RHP Jack Mahan, who is second with five strikeouts.
